4 Replies Latest reply on Jun 18, 2003 2:54 AM by sradford

    DatabaseServerLoginModule in 3.2.1

    mozheyko_d

      I read previous topic and
      I wrote:

      ############################
      database.sql
      ############################
      ...
      create table jboss_users(
      code integer not null primary key,
      name varchar( 20),
      passwd varchar( 20),
      therole varchar( 20)
      );

      insert into jboss_users values ( 1, 'dm', 'dm', 'admin');
      insert into jboss_users values ( 2, 'qwerty', 'qwerty', 'user');
      ...
      ############################
      server/default/conf/login-config.xml
      ############################
      ...
      <application-policy name = "mozheyko">

      <login-module code = "org.jboss.security.auth.spi.DatabaseServerLoginModule" flag = "required">
      <module-option name="dsJndiName">java:/FirebirdDS</module-option>
      <module-option name="pricipalsQuery">select passwd from jboss_users where name=?</module-option>
      <module-option name="rolesQuery">select therole, 'Roles' from jboss_users where name=?</module-option>
      </login-module>

      </application-policy>
      ...
      ############################
      jboss-web.xml
      ############################
      ...
      <security-domain>java:/jaas/mozheyko</security-domain>
      ...

      ############################

      and turn DEBUG level in log4j.xml

      I RECEIVE:
      ...
      2003-06-17 16:16:53,278 DEBUG [org.jboss.jetty.security.JBossUserRealm#Main servlet] JBossUserPrincipal: dm
      2003-06-17 16:16:53,283 DEBUG [org.jboss.jetty.security.JBossUserRealm#Main servlet] created JBossUserRealm::JBossUserPrincipal: admin
      2003-06-17 16:16:53,284 DEBUG [org.jboss.jetty.security.JBossUserRealm#Main servlet] authenticating: Name:admin Password:****2003-06-17
      ...
      16:16:53,316 DEBUG [org.firebirdsql.jca.FBManagedConnection] preparing sql: select Password from Principals where
      PrincipalID=?

      ...
      What i forget and whence this quiry has undertaken ?